DECATUR - The answer this week to the question, "What's Biting?" is still white bass. The suggested destination last week was Lake Shelbyville. But, try Lake Decatur for white bass if smaller lakes are more your style.
That advice is from JoAnna Lowe, who owns Mike's Tackle World in Decatur with her husband. Mike Lowe and his grandson, 7-year-old Austin, have been filling 5-gallon pails with the feisty white bass measuring 10-inches and more every time they venture out on the water.
